1968 Porsche 911L

The 911 L was limited to just 499 examples in 1968 for the American market. The ‘L’ designation, for ‘Luxe,’ was essentially the European premier ‘S’ model fitted with an air-pump equipped engine to meet the safety and emissions regulations exacted stateside.
